Abstract :Since protons are not fundamental particles, they produce very large backgrounds in proton-proton collisions. Therefore, in supersymmetry searches, the main challenge is to differentiate supersymmetric signals from Standard Model background. Hence, extensive background analysis becomes an important probe to obtain information in the direction of supersymmetry searches. Among the variety of signatures in this direction, single lepton channel is one of the effective processes in which Standard Model background is obtained. In this work, starting from the generation of background emerging from various events, basic selections and cuts have been applied to obtain a homogenous and a clean sample. On the other hand, the magnitude of missing transverse energy and scalar sum of all transverse momentums are crucial to detect particles that can escape without leaving trace in the detector. Therefore, all necessary histograms have been plotted. Emerging the leading backgrounds from W-bosons + jets and top quark-antiquark + jets events, almost all energy regions, it is seen that W+jets have greater contribution to background. However, for the collisions that produce high number of jets top quark-antiquark + jets become more dominant.
